Old switch and new switch have to be compared using multi-meter or continuity tester.
Each 3-speed switch has identical pull-chain sequence: off-high-medium-low.
Each 3-speed switch has only one wire that connects to Hot wire.
But the other three wires can vary.
For example connect power to switch Hot wire. Let's say switch is in off position. Pull chain once for high speed and power might flow to just one wire, or it might flow to two wires, depending on the switch.
Pull chain again for medium speed, and power might flow to just one wire, or it might flow to two different wires.
Pull chain again for low speed, and power usually flows to just one wire.
Easiest place to start is to find which wire is Hot.
Only one wire connects to Hot power.
That same wire on the new 3-speed switch will connect to all other wires. When testing, only one wire connects to all other wires.
Once hot wire is determined.
Then test which sequence of wires receives power each time chain is pulled.
Repeat same test on old switch.
Note how old switch was connected. And then map the change-over to new switch.

Hello. I really hope the 2nd grey is simply a faded purple or green. The most common configurations would be: L - Black, 1 - Grey, 2 - Brown, 3 - Purple or green.
